#4ec3e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ec3e6 is composed of 30.6% red, 76.5%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 193.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 60.4%. #4ec3e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#0087cd.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#4ec3e6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4ec3e6 has RGB values of R:78, G:195,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5161958.

Hex triplet 4ec3e6 #4ec3e6
RGB Decimal 78, 195, 230 rgb(78,195,230)
RGB Percent 30.6, 76.5, 90.2 rgb(30.6%,76.5%,90.2%)
CMYK 66, 15, 0, 10
HSL 193.8°, 75.2, 60.4 hsl(193.8,75.2%,60.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 193.8°, 66.1, 90.2
Web Safe 66ccff #66ccff
CIE-LAB 73.779, -22.104, -27.068
XYZ 36.936, 46.36, 81.86
xyY 0.224, 0.281, 46.36
CIE-LCH 73.779, 34.947, 230.764
CIE-LUV 73.779, -44.848, -39.971
Hunter-Lab 68.088, -22.323, -23.621
Binary 01001110, 11000011, 11100110

Shades and Tints of #4ec3e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0c is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4ec3e6 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a4a4a4 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#93aab1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#afb7dd Protanopia 1% of men
  • #acb6ed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#4bc8d7 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8cbbe0 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#89baea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#4cc6dc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
